AI Technical Summary
During the assembly of jewelry mirror cabinets, inexperienced personnel may cause the side panels to be misaligned, affecting the assembly result.
A positioning device is designed, comprising a base plate, a first clamping frame, and a positioning clamping component. The clamping frame and the positioning clamping component are used to accurately position the side plate. The position of the side plate is adjusted by adjusting screws, nuts, and sliders, and alignment is ensured by using positioning scale lines.
This effectively reduces side panel installation misalignment, improving the assembly precision and aesthetics of the jewelry mirror cabinet.

Technical Field
[0001] This utility model relates to the field of jewelry mirror cabinet furniture assembly technology, specifically to a positioning device for assembling jewelry mirror cabinet furniture. Background Technology
[0002] A jewelry mirror cabinet is a type of home furniture specifically designed for storing and displaying jewelry. It typically integrates mirror and storage functions. In practice, people often make their own jewelry mirror cabinets using boards to place the jewelry. During the manufacturing process, people need to connect and fix the two side panels to the base panel to build the frame of the jewelry mirror cabinet.
[0003] During the fixing process, the two side panels need to be fixed to the outer sides of the base plate. In order to ensure the aesthetics and structural stability of the jewelry mirror cabinet, the distance between the side panels and the two edges of the base plate should be the same. However, if the personnel are inexperienced, the side panels will often be misaligned when they are placed, which will result in the assembled jewelry mirror cabinet not meeting the personnel's needs. Therefore, there are still some shortcomings.
[0004] In conclusion, it is necessary to invent a positioning device for assembling jewelry mirror cabinet furniture. Utility Model Content
[0005] Therefore, this utility model provides a positioning device for assembling jewelry mirror cabinet furniture to solve the problem that when people are inexperienced, the side panels are often misaligned during installation, resulting in the assembled jewelry mirror cabinet not meeting the needs of the people.

Detailed Implementation
[0022] The preferred embodiments of the present invention will be described below with reference to the accompanying drawings. It should be understood that the preferred embodiments described herein are for illustration and explanation only and are not intended to limit the present invention.
[0023] See attached document Figures 1-4 This utility model provides a positioning device for assembling jewelry mirror cabinet furniture, including a base plate 100. First clamping frames 110 are provided on both the front and rear sides of the top edge of the outer wall of the base plate 100 to clamp the base plate. The bottom edges of the outer walls of the first clamping frames 110 are connected to the front and rear edges of the top edge of the outer wall of the base plate 100 via columns 130. The first clamping frames 110 can be detachably connected to the top edge of the outer wall of the base plate 100 using bolts or other fasteners. The columns 130 support the first clamping frames 110. A fixing pressure plate 121 for clamping the base plate is provided on the upper edge of the inner wall of each first clamping frame 110. An adjusting screw hole is provided at the top of the outer wall of the frame 110, corresponding to the center of the top of the outer wall of the fixed pressure plate 121. The inner wall of the adjusting screw hole is threaded with an adjusting screw 120. The bottom end of the adjusting screw 120 is rotatably connected to the center of the top of the outer wall of the fixed pressure plate 121. The person can place the bottom plate of the jewelry mirror cabinet furniture on the inner side of the first clamping frame 110, and then rotate the adjusting screw 120 to move the fixed pressure plate 121 downward to press the bottom plate of the jewelry mirror cabinet furniture. In this way, the bottom plate of the jewelry mirror cabinet furniture can be clamped and fixed by the two first clamping frames 110. The first clamping frames 110 need to clamp the center position of the bottom plate of the jewelry mirror cabinet furniture.
[0024] Positioning and clamping components for clamping and positioning the side panels of the jewelry mirror cabinet furniture are provided at the top of the outer wall of the base plate 100 and on both sides of the first clamping frame 110. The positioning and clamping components include side support plates 230. The side support plates 230 are all provided on both sides of the bottom end of the outer wall of the base plate of the jewelry mirror cabinet furniture. A sleeve 200 is provided below the bottom end of the outer wall of the side support plate 230. The bottom end of the sleeve 200 abuts against the top of the outer wall of the base plate 100. A threaded rod 210 is sleeved on the inner wall of the sleeve 200. The side support plates 230 can support the bottom sides of the base plate of the jewelry mirror cabinet furniture.
[0025] A vertical plate 240 is installed above the top of the outer wall of the side support plate 230. Adjusting nuts 220 are rotatably connected to the top of the outer wall of the sleeve 200. The inner wall of the adjusting nut 220 is threadedly connected to the outer wall of the threaded rod 210. The sleeve 200 can adjust the distance of the threaded rod 210 via the adjusting nut 220. Personnel can rotate the adjusting nut 220 to control the up-and-down movement of the threaded rod 210, thereby adjusting the height of the side support plate 230. A certain amount of damping is provided between the adjusting nut 220 and the top of the outer wall of the sleeve 200. The upper end of the threaded rod 210 is fixed to the bottom of the outer wall of the side support plate 230. Curved sliders 241 are fixed to the bottom of the outer wall of the vertical plate 240. Adjustment grooves are provided at the top of the outer wall of the side support plate 230 and at the corresponding positions of the curved slider 241. The outer wall of the curved slider 241 is slidably connected to the inner wall of the adjustment groove. Locking bolts 242 for pressing the curved slider 241 are provided on the front and rear sides of the top of the outer wall of the side support plate 230. The bottom end of the locking bolt 242 is threaded to both sides of the top of the outer wall of the curved slider 241. Specifically, a strip-shaped clearance groove is provided at the top of the outer wall of the side support plate 230 at the position corresponding to the locking bolt 242. Personnel can adjust the position of the upright plate 240 as needed, and then fix the side support plate 230 and the curved slider 241 by tightening the locking bolt 242, thereby achieving the purpose of fixing the upright plate 240.
[0026] Positioning scale lines 280 are fixed on the top of the outer wall of the side support plate 230 and on both the front and rear sides of the base plate of the jewelry mirror furniture. These positioning scale lines 280 can be aligned with the edge of the base plate, allowing personnel to adjust the placement of the side panels according to the positioning scale lines 280. The upright plate 240 is fixed with connecting rods 250 near the base plate, and the other end of each connecting rod 250 is connected to a second clamping frame 260 for holding the side panels. The number of second clamping frames 260 is [not specified]. There are two second clamping frames 260, which are respectively set on the upper and lower sides of the side panel of the jewelry mirror cabinet furniture. The outer walls of the two adjacent second clamping frames 260 are fixed with connecting slide plates 271. Connecting sleeve plates 270 are slidably connected to the opposite side of the connecting slide plates 271. The upper and lower ends of the connecting sleeve plates 270 are fixedly connected to the connecting slide plates 271 by fixing bolts. The second clamping frames 260 are equipped with second screws and clamping plates. Personnel can use the second screws and clamping plates to clamp and fix the second clamping frames 260 to the front and rear outer walls of the side panel of the jewelry mirror cabinet furniture. The distance between the two second clamping frames 260 can be adjusted by the connecting sleeve plates 270 and the connecting slide plates 271.
[0027] The usage process of this utility model is as follows: Those skilled in the art can first assemble the device according to the above instructions. Then, personnel can take out the base plate of the jewelry mirror cabinet furniture to be fixed, and place its center position between the first clamping frames 110. Then, by rotating the adjusting screw 120, the fixing plate 121 moves downward to clamp and fix the outer wall of the jewelry mirror cabinet furniture base plate. Next, personnel can take out the sleeves 200 and place the four sleeves 200 at the four corners of the bottom edge of the outer wall of the jewelry mirror cabinet furniture base plate. Then, holding the side support plate 230 with one hand, and rotating the adjusting nut 220, the threaded rod 210 drives the side support plate 230 downward, so that the top of the side support plate 230 abuts against the bottom edge of the outer wall of the jewelry mirror cabinet furniture base plate. Then, the positioning scale line 280 is aligned with the front and rear ends of the outer wall of the jewelry mirror cabinet furniture base plate. Finally, personnel can take out the jewelry mirror cabinet furniture side plate and insert it between the second clamping frames 260. Before insertion, personnel can adjust the position of the jewelry mirror cabinet furniture side plate according to the following instructions. The height of the second clamping frame 260 is adjusted to adjust the distance between the two clamping frames. After adjustment, the second screw and clamping plate are used to clamp and fix the second clamping frame 260 to the front and rear outer walls of the jewelry mirror furniture side panel. This allows the jewelry mirror furniture side panel to stand on the jewelry mirror furniture base. Then, the distance between the jewelry mirror furniture side panel and the edge of the jewelry mirror furniture base can be adjusted according to the pre-drawn dimensions. After adjustment, the locking bolt 242 can be removed to fix the side support plate 230 and the curved slider 241 to achieve the purpose of fixing the jewelry mirror furniture side panel and the jewelry mirror furniture base. Then, the personnel can use adhesive or a nail gun to initially fix the jewelry mirror furniture side panel and the jewelry mirror furniture base. Then, the personnel can loosen the screw on the second clamping frame 260, and then unscrew the bolt of the fixing column 130. The first clamping frame 110 can be removed from both sides of the jewelry mirror furniture base. Then, the side support plate 230 can be removed from both sides of the jewelry mirror furniture base.
